What is the past tense of doff your clothes?

What's the past tense of doff your clothes? Here's the word you're looking for.

Answer

The past tense of doff your clothes is doffed your clothes.

The third-person singular simple present indicative form of doff your clothes is doffs your clothes.

The present participle of doff your clothes is doffing your clothes.

The past participle of doff your clothes is doffed your clothes.
